Zero rated tax means , All Export and supply to SEZ Units are Zero rated supply and Exempt supply means Exemption by of notification by the GOVT on certain Goods and services in public interest .
The most significant difference between the two is that Zero rated tax gives the benefit to claim Input Tax Credit, whereas Exempted tax doesn't allow one to take ITC for the inputs of exempted goods as it will lead to negative taxation.
